    Maine State Police officers confer Saturday in a tactical vehicle before entering the Shue residence on Prescott Road in Manchester. Officers went to the house about 7:45 a.m. when a man called police to say he had killed his wife. Troopers entered the house in the afternoon and discovered that both occupants, Clyde and Kim Shue, were dead.
